A long-form podcast exploring how people quietly shape their identities through ordinary days, invisible decisions, unfinished goals, private struggles, changing ambitions, and moments nobody else notices.
Most transformations do not begin with dramatic announcements, overnight success, or life-changing moments. They begin quietly.
This episode explores the invisible architecture of everyday life—the routines people repeat, the beliefs they inherit, the expectations they carry, and the choices that slowly become identity. Through reflective storytelling, observations, and conversations about modern life, we examine what it means to grow while nobody is watching.
Why do some people feel lost despite achieving what they wanted? Why do others find fulfillment in smaller lives than they imagined? How much of who we become is intentional—and how much is simply repetition?
Across work, relationships, ambition, creativity, technology, and personal change, this episode follows the idea that meaningful transformation is rarely loud. It is built in silence.
